- [ ] Step 7: Archive cold storage buckets (Glacierline tier). Confirm both ceremony witnesses are present, verify bucket manifests match the Oxbow ledger, then seal the archive key shares. Plugin authors may observe but not handle shares. Once sealed, the archive index itself is encrypted and can only be reopened with the passphrase below.

vault phrase of badup-hahig = tamael-aldael-kelmir-istael-fenok-istwyn-tamius-jorath-oliion

Renamed setting: the env variable previously named DEDUP_UPSTREAM_AUTH is now split so that alert ingestion and suppression-rule sync authenticate independently. This matters because the old single credential let a compromised ingest node rewrite suppression rules, silently muting pages. Future maintainers: the migration script removes the old variable but intentionally does not create the new one, to force a deliberate rotation. After running the migration on each dedup node, edit its env file and add the new setting on the following line.

sealed setting: ARCHIVE_KEY3=8d0

// SLIM_LAYER_BUDGET_MB: max layer size for Ferrowisp base images.
// Set to 180 after the distroless migration; anything larger suggests
// stray build tooling leaked into the runtime stage. CI fails the
// image-diff check when exceeded. Reviewers: if you bump this, note why
// in the PR. Last enforced in the build identified by the token below.

pipeline stamp: htk31_f769b577b3028a4e9958e5bb8d1259a